ICS-CBFTE

International Cooperation Scheme- Capacity Building of First Time MSE Exporters

What this is

The scheme “International Cooperation Scheme” was launched by the MSME, Govt. of India with the aim to capacity build MSMEs for entering export market by providing reimbursement of various costs incurred by first time MSE exporters on export shipments.

In detail

The sub-scheme "Capacity Building of First Time MSE Exporters" under the “International Cooperation Scheme” was launched by the Ministry of Micro, Small and Medium Enterprises, Government of India to capacity build MSMEs for entering the export market by facilitating their participation in international exhibitions/fairs/conferences/seminars/buyer-seller meets abroad as well as providing them with actionable market-intelligence and reimbursement of various costs involved in export of goods and services. The Scheme provides opportunities for MSMEs to continuously update themselves to meet the challenges emerging out of changes in technology, changes in demand, the emergence of new markets, etc. Thus, in totality, all components of the scheme aimed at various aspects required to advance MSMEs' position as emerging export players.

The key interventions proposed under the scheme are highlighted below:-

Reimbursement of costs incurred by first-time MSE exporters on export shipments –

  • Registration-cum-Membership Certificate (RCMC) paid by the first-time exporters for registration with EPCs.
  • Export insurance premiums paid by MSEs.
  • Fee paid on Testing and Quality Certification acquired by MSEs to export products. This will encourage MSEs to produce and offer products and services of international standards for the export markets.

Who qualifies

  • The Micro and Small Enterprises with valid Udyam Registration are eligible to apply under the scheme.
  • To claim the benefits under the scheme, the applicant's Importer Exporter Code (IEC) must not be older than 3 years on the date of export shipment.

What you get

> Scale of Assistance and Eligible Items of Expenditure:

Financial assistance towards costs incurred by first-time MSE Exporters on export shipments:-

Registration-cum-Membership Certificate (RCMC) charges/fee paid by the first-time exporter to relate EPCs 75% of the cost paid subject to a maximum of ₹20,000/- or actual, whichever is lower subject to quarterly reporting by EPCs as per prescribed format. Export Insurance Premium paid to Export Credit Guarantee Corporation Ltd. (ECGC) under the ECGC's Small Exporter's PolicyMaximum financial assistance in a financial year of ₹10,000/- or actual, whichever is lower subject to quarterly reporting by ECGC Ltd. as per prescribed formatFee paid on Testing & Quality Certification acquired by MSEs to Export Products (Note: Ministry of MSME shall share the list of beneficiaries who have availed the financial assistance under this sub-component, with MAI Division, Department of Commerce, on quarterly basis)75% of the testing and quality certification with a ceiling of ₹1.00 Lakh or actual, whichever is lower, subject to the following conditions: 1. Financial assistance is allowed for a maximum of 3 certificates per financial year with a ceiling of ₹1.00 Lakh per MSE unit. 2. Certificate, for which financial assistance is requested, should be attained within the same financial year.
